Which irrigation system makes the most efficient use of water?

Drip irrigation





Drip irrigation is the most water-efficient way to irrigate many different plantings. It is an ideal way to water in clay soils because the water is applied slowly, allowing the soil to absorb the water and avoid runoff.

How can water productivity be increased?

One of the field-level methods for increasing water productivity is deficit irrigation, where deliberately less water is applied than that required to meet the full crop water demand. The prescribed water deficit should result in a small yield reduction that is less than the concomitant reduction in transpiration.

Which irrigation method uses water least efficiently?





In many parts of the world flood or surface, irrigation is still used where water flows across a field and soaks into the soil. Surface or flood irrigation is the least efficient manner of irrigation.

What is water application efficiency?

Water application efficiency refers to the amount of water applied that is stored in the crop root zone. This value is determined by water distribution characteristics, system management, soil conditions, the crop, and weather conditions. Water application efficiency pertains to an individual irrigation event.

How can we improve irrigation and agriculture water use?

Approaches to using less water



You can improve irrigation efficiency by irrigation scheduling, adopting practices such as deficit irrigation and conservation tillage, and installing more efficient irrigation systems. Sprinkler and drip irrigation systems are more efficient than furrow irrigation.

How do water supply influence irrigation practices?



5 Water supply. The quality and quantity of the source of water can have a significant impact on the irrigation practices. Crop water demands are continuous during the growing season. The soil moisture reservoir transforms this continuous demand into a periodic one which the irrigation system can service.

Can hard water be used for irrigation?

Without treatment, irrigation using hard water delivers calcium carbonate to the crop in its calcite state which can form a coating on the roots and the leaves, like putting a coating of sunscreen on plant. This prohibits the plant from receiving the maximum benefit from the water, minerals, fertilizers and pesticides.

What is poor quality irrigation water?

Poor quality irrigation water is not suitable for use in sprinkler method of irrigation. Crops sprinkled with waters having excess quantities of specific ions such as Na and Cl cause leaf burn.

Can you irrigate with softened water?

Most of the time it is not a good idea to water your garden with softened water. The reason for this is that softened water typically has a high amount of sodium, which is attained from salt. Most plants cannot tolerate high amounts of salt.

Will the water softener water damage the grass?

For outside use on lawns or gardens, using softened water is wasteful. Where the concentration of hardness minerals is high, the sodium content after softening may be high enough to slow plant growth and harm grass.
